mirror of
https://github.com/tinygrad/tinygrad.git
synced 2026-06-24 02:14:17 +00:00
* connect to gpu
* rlc init?
* gfx comp start init
* early init is hardoded, some progress with fw
* gart
* progress, next mqd
* ring setup, still does not execute anything
* ugh write correct reg
* pci2: vm
* pci2: start psp
* vm seems to work
* pci2: gfx start
* pci2: fix psp ring resp
* pci2: try ring
* pci2: mes and some fixes
* pci2: some progress
* pci2: progress
* pci2: mm
* pci2: discovery
* pci2: correct apertures
* pci2: b
* pci2: i
* pci2: l
* pci2: o
* pci2: cmu
* pci2: mes_kiq works
* pci2: mes
* pci2: kcq does not work(
* pci2: unhalt gfx
* ops_am
* minor
* check if amdgpu is there, or we will crash
* bring back graph, it just works
* less prints
* do not init mes (not used)
* remove unused files
* ops_am: start move into core
* ops_am: works
* clcks, but still slower
* faster + no mes_kiq
* vm frags + remove mes
* cleanup fw
* gmc tiny cleanup
* move to ops_amd
* comment out what we dont really need
* driverless
* close in speed
* am clean most of ips
* gmc to ips
* cleaner
* new vm walker
* comment old one
* remove unsued autogens
* last write ups
* remove psp hardcoded values
* more
* add logs
* ih
* p2p and sdma
* vfio hal and interrupts
* smth
* amd dev iface
* minor after rebase
* bind for sdma
* Revert "bind for sdma"
This reverts commit
|
||
|---|---|---|
| .. | ||
| amdgpu_doorbell.h | ||
| amdgpu_irq.h | ||
| amdgpu_psp.h | ||
| amdgpu_smu.h | ||
| amdgpu_ucode.h | ||
| amdgpu_vm.h | ||
| discovery.h | ||
| gc_11_0_0_offset.h | ||
| gc_11_0_0_sh_mask.h | ||
| mmhub_3_0_0_offset.h | ||
| mmhub_3_0_0_sh_mask.h | ||
| mp_11_0_offset.h | ||
| mp_11_0_sh_mask.h | ||
| mp_13_0_0_offset.h | ||
| mp_13_0_0_sh_mask.h | ||
| nbio_4_3_0_offset.h | ||
| nbio_4_3_0_sh_mask.h | ||
| osssys_6_0_0_offset.h | ||
| osssys_6_0_0_sh_mask.h | ||
| psp_gfx_if.h | ||
| smu13_driver_if_v13_0_0.h | ||
| smu_v13_0_0_ppsmc.h | ||
| soc15_ih_clientid.h | ||
| soc21_enum.h | ||
| v11_structs.h | ||